1. Naked fanatic infantry said to be recruitable by Carthage in liguria but are not. did something change?

2. building advanced markets yields very little trade income compared with the huge cost. is there some kind of cumulative effect in place to justify it?

3. as pahlava trade caravans seem to yield peanuts compared with their cost, again is there some kind of cumulative trade bonus that multiplies with the amount built or should i just save my money?

4. as pahlava ive tried "role-playing" by not attacking the seleukids at first and letting them have it out with the ptolemaoi. however they seem to have other plans, anyway to get the stupid AI to deal with bigger fish instead of attacking its allies?

5. pahlava AI getting annihilated consistenly, anyway to remedy this?

6. is there a way to appoint recruited generals as family members?

1. Said where? Recruitment Viewer? That program is tad outdated.

2. Sort of. The larger your population gets, the larger the bonus becomes, which is a percentage-based perk as opposed to being a permanent one-time buff. But generally, high-level markets are not very good at paying off their value. Far, far better to reduce corruption with law buildings, if you have corruptions, which will dramatically increase the income.

3. See above. Wait until you are wealthy to build them, although their costs are lower, so build a low-level caravan and wait until upgrading it.

4. I suppose you can try the "teleport armies" cheat to maroon the AS armies in Ptolemaic lands.

5. Add money via console. Change "decr_strat" (if you want to go further with this, just ask me in this thread how to do it) to give them more troops in the beginning. And they do not always get butchered. I have seen many games where they became the "purple rain" or a gargantuan empire.

6. Man of the Hour. Have them fight a preferably sizeable battle. The more the odds are against you, the better. If you have not reached the FM limit (roughly two territories per FM you have), the MotH message will pop up after a victory.

2. building advanced markets yields very little trade income compared with the huge cost. is there some kind of cumulative effect in place to justify it?

3. as pahlava trade caravans seem to yield peanuts compared with their cost, again is there some kind of cumulative trade bonus that multiplies with the amount built or should i just save my money?


Build paved roads ASAP. They are the most cost-effective building in EB and will be instrumental for your economy, especially if you play Pahlava.
